2018 From Garment Manufacturer to Licenser: Journey of Turkey’s Aydınlı Group

This paper contributes to the literature by introducing a new form of outsourcing. In 2005 France’s Pierre Cardin outsourced its licenser function to Turkey’s Aydınlı Group. This paper illustrates the journey of Aydınlı Group from a garment manufacturer to a licenser as a case study. Based on semi-structured interviews with company officials and secondary information retrieved from open sources I conclude that regional competence and local know-how as well as trust are the main factors that motivated Pierre Cardin, the brand owner, to outsource its licenser function. We further found that outsourcing licenser function provides additional benefits for brand owner such as establishing brands in new territories, better protection for trademarks and generating more revenue. In addition, outsourcing provides firms in fashion industry, which is characterized as a rapid changing industry, the ability to reduce overall costs and risks, while reaping the benefits of ideas from partners worldwide. Finally, we found that the brand reputation of Pierre Cardin is the main factor that motivated Aydınlı Group to enter into a strategic partnership with Pierre Cardin instead of building its own brand.
